The Glasgow based band of three, Prides, formed in 2013 out of the ashes of several local bands. They premiered on the internet last summer with their track "Out of the Blue" which lived on the top five of the Hype Machine. The bands unique sound attracted the attention of Island Records in the UK and Virgin Records in the US, who signed them to the labels. Stewart Brock sings and plays keyboards, Callum Wiseman is lead guitarist, plays keys and sings and Lewis Gardiner plays drums and is the bands producer.
The Seeds You Sow is an anthemic feel-good track with tumbling drums and repetitive chant-like vocals.
Stewart says, "The Seeds You Sow is about realizing that the things that happen around you are a result of your own actions. It's about realizing that the one you're with isn't the one, and the consequences that go with it. We wanted to make sure that it was loud, brave, and would grab people as soon as they heard it. The vocal hook is all about letting go, losing yourself, shouting as loud as you can, caution to the wind."
